#44274f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#44274f is composed of 26.7% red, 15.3% green and 31%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 13.9% cyan, 50.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 69% black. It has a hue angle of 283.5 degrees, a saturation of 33.9% and a lightness of 23.1%. #44274f color hex could be obtained by blending #884e9e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333366.

● #44274f color description : Very dark desaturated violet.
#44274f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#44274f has RGB values of R:68, G:39, B:79 and CMYK values of C:0.14, M:0.51, Y:0, K:0.69. Its decimal value is 4466511.
